Transaction 821f34ee2095cb71381d3b101a7580c2179d71a0633acc1957b5ad78bdf3030e

1 Input
1 Outputs
  • 821f34ee2095cb71381d3b101a7580c2179d71a0633acc1957b5ad78bdf3030e:0
  • value  257250
    address  bc1q77r8ctga5cyedapsnhldf005r8em8q6guv5qrk